Australia Extend Lead atop ODI Rankings

Dubai: Reigning world champions Australia have consolidated their lead over second-ranked India at the top of the Reliance ICC ODI rankings while the West Indies, Bangladesh and Pakistan will be engaged in a tight struggle to secure the remaining two slots in the ICC Champions Trophy 2017.

The annual update has seen world cup runner-up New Zealand making the biggest move as they jumped eight points to be third-ranked ahead of South Africa.

England, meanwhile, made the biggest fall as they have surrendered seven points, dropping to sixth-ranked, 12 points behind fifth-ranked Sri Lanka.

The ICC Champions Trophy 2017 will be played from 1 to 19 June in England and Wales, and the host country (England), plus the next seven highest-ranked ODI sides will participate in the event.

The annual update is carried out to ensure the table continues to reflect results from the last three years. As such, results from 2011-12 have been dropped while the results from 2013-14 have been reduced to a weighting of 50 per cent.

Full ODI ratings:

  1. Australia (129)
  2. India (117)
  3. New Zealand (116)
  4. South Africa (112)
  5. Sri Lanka (106)
  6. England (94)
  7. West Indies (88)
  8. Bangladesh (88)
  9. Pakistan (87)
  10. Ireland (50)
  11. Zimbabwe (45)
  12. Afghanistan (41)
